JScript

Programação & Desenvolvimento


Você não está conectado. Conecte-se ou registre-se

Como executar um bloco de funções - jQuery

2 participantes

Ir para baixo  Mensagem [Página 1 de 1]

waghcwb

waghcwb
Desenvolvedores
Desenvolvedores

Olá amigos tenho um bloco de funções bem grande aqui, gostaria de saber como faço para executa-los em 'cascata', digamos primeiro ele executa um código, depois outro e por ai vai...
Vejam:
Código:
//document ready
$(function(){
 function functions(){
 //functions
 function myFunction(){
 alert('teste 1');
 }
 function anotherFunction(){
 alert('teste 2 ');
 }
 function moreFunction(){
 alert('teste 3');
 }
 function addFunction(){
 alert('teste 4');
 }
 }
});
//verifico se um elemento existe
$(function(){
 if ( $('.myElement').length) {
 functions();
 }
});

Como faço para que meu bloco inicial de scripts ali seja executado em cascata? Tipo o primeiro é executado, e o restante só executado quando aquele for terminar de carregar?
Agradeço a atenção desde já!

http://wagneraugusto.com.br/

joelson0007

joelson0007
Moderadores
Moderadores

Sempre que preciso colocar uma função dentro de uma função (Apesar de sempre tentar evitar isso), eu declaro ela com um variável dessa maneira;

Código:

(function(){
var a = function(){
  console.log('a')
}
var b = function(){
  console.log('b')
}
var c = function(){
  console.log('c')
}

a()
b()
c()
  
})();

waghcwb

waghcwb
Desenvolvedores
Desenvolvedores

Olá Joelson, obrigado amigo.. Antes de ver sua resposta eu fiz uns testes aqui e consegui o resultado fazendo uma função que 'chama' todas as outras funções, assim:
Código:
function func1(){
    alert('teste 1');
}
function func2(){
    alert('teste 2');
}
function runFunc(){
    func1();
    func2();
}

E consegui o efeito que eu queria para meu novo código Very Happy

http://jscript.forumeiros.com/t615-xlider-galeria-de-imagens-na-homepage#4085

http://wagneraugusto.com.br/

Conteúdo patrocinado



Ir para o topo  Mensagem [Página 1 de 1]

Permissões neste sub-fórum
Não podes responder a tópicos